Cemented carbide, commonly known for its durability and solidity, plays a vital duty across different sectors. Composed mainly of tungsten carbide (WC) fragments adhered with a metal binder, such as cobalt, cemented carbide combines the stamina of tungsten with the toughness of other steels. The composition of cemented carbides can be tailored to fit certain applications, leading to the production of selections like YG15, yg6, and yg20 tungsten carbide. YG6, for example, is known for its high wear resistance and is usually used in reducing devices and equipment where precision is critical. YG20 and YG15 tungsten carbide are utilized depending on the needed balance between hardness and sturdiness, making them highly looked for after in numerous commercial circumstances.

The term carbide, as a whole, describes a course of substances developed by the chemical combination of carbon with a more electropositive element. In most sensible applications, carbides are developed when steels like tungsten or titanium are integrated with carbon, forming materials like tungsten carbide. Tungsten carbide itself is a dark grey to black, thick material that flaunts excellent firmness, ranking second just to ruby in terms of material firmness. With a density usually around 15.6 g/cm SIX, tungsten carbide is significantly denser than steel, permitting it to be utilized in applications needing significant wear resistance and strength. This one-of-a-kind mix of properties is why tungsten carbide is frequently referred to as a hard metal, a term that encompasses numerous products understood for their extraordinary hardness and durability.

Tungsten powder and carbon are blended together and heated up to a temperature high adequate to precipitate the development of tungsten carbide. The addition of cobalt or nickel offers as a binder to hold the tungsten carbide bits with each other, resulting in a solid material that is both strong and immune to abrasion.

The comparison in between carbide and tungsten carbide discloses some crucial distinctions. While carbide can describe any kind of carbon compound with a metal, tungsten carbide definitely signifies the mix of tungsten with carbon. Tungsten carbide, in certain, offers distinct homes, consisting of high density, significant hardness, and outstanding resistance to wear, making it extremely adaptable throughout different fields. While both materials are made use of to boost tool life and increase efficiency, the specific options will greatly depend upon the wanted efficiency attributes.

Aside from tungsten carbide, one more appropriate material in the discussion of hard steels is Stellite, commonly recognized for its outstanding wear resistance and warm resistance in difficult settings. While tungsten carbide stands out in solidity, Stellite materials are typically preferred for applications calling for both stamina and resistance to environmental aspects.

In regards to its thermal residential or commercial properties, tungsten carbide has a high melting point, normally around 2,870 degrees Celsius (5,200 levels Fahrenheit), which offers superb security in high-temperature applications. Such thermal security makes tungsten carbide an excellent candidate for cutting and machining procedures that encounter increased friction and warm. Its capacity to sustain stress and anxiety and heat without warping additional boosts its worth in environments where conventional devices might fall short.
